Safety Manager
Employment Type: Permanent, Full-Time
Location: 100 Forester Street, North Vancouver, British Columbia
Hours: 40 hours per week
Salary: 100k-120k
Travel: 20 %
ERCO Worldwide is looking for a Safety Manager to join the North Vancouver team. The primary functions are ensuring site OH&S; and security practices meet or exceed corporate and regulatory procedures and policies, coordinating site regulatory training, maintaining regulatory records for safety and security, overseeing Responsible Care Safety and Security activities, monitoring process safety, and reporting to plant management.
The Role
Ensure site compliance to all government regulated requirements
Implement company-wide policies and procedures that apply to the site
Develop, maintain, and implement site plans, policies, procedures, and support continuous improvement of these internal standards
Develop, maintain, and implement site training programs, ensuring site employees, contractors and visitors are trained as required, including emergency response activities
Lead all regulatory reporting and documentation requirements both external and internal
Keep site leadership team and Toronto head office up to date on site issues
Ensure compliance to CIAC requirements
Promote a positive safety culture through good practices and reporting hazards using our reporting application
Coordinate completion of associated tasks delegated to site employees
Participate as member of site Joint Health and Safety Committee and ERCO Safety Committee, acting as liaison to the Plant Manager
Lead and support incident investigations, analyze incidents to identify areas of concern, prepare incident reports when appropriate
Trend and analyze site performance for KPIs required throughout the year
Liaise with government, community and emergency responders as required
Integrate company-wide annual safety plan with site safety plan
Follow up on assigned actions in a timely manner
The Person
University degree – academic technical (preferred) or equivalent OH&S; technical training/experience
Recognized CRSP (Canadian Registered Safety Professional) designation or enrollment in a recognized safety program leading to it
Minimum 3 years’ experience working in an industrial/manufacturing environment (sodium chlorate industry preferred)
Excellent understanding and hands‑on experience with industrial safety practices: lock out, confined space, safety inspections, hazard assessments
Strong communication skills, verbal and written, to convey information appropriately to all levels of the organization
Proficient computer skills
